Databases: restore with mysql < sql instead of -e source sql

Version 1.58


When restoring the load of the backup/*.sql files will now be down with a stdin pipe method, eg: mysql --defaults-extra-file=path_for_user_my.cnf --host=localhost (extra_mysql_restore_options) db_name < /path/to/db.sql instead of the previous: mysql --defaults-extra-file=path_for_user_my.cnf -e "source /path/to/db.sql" --host=localhost (extra_mysql_restore_options) db_name as it was found some cases with -e "source .sql" caused mysql to return a zero exit code, hiding relevant errors that were there.

